Abstract
A kind of flexible enclosure, is connected by tablet and is surrounded, and is mainly characterized by, and two neighboring tablet is connected by flexible connector;The flexible connector is configured as deforming, for compensating movement of the tablet relative to the flexible connector.The present invention is not only had outer extensional energy, is facilitated the vanning of article to be shipped and unload case using the flexible enclosure for being above structure;And also there is pretightning force, transport article is not damaged in effective protection box body;The box body is also convenient for recycling simultaneously, environmental protection and energy saving.
Description
Technical field
The present invention relates to a kind of flexible enclosures.
Background technology
Be packaged for article, the box body of transport is typically corrugated case, such as by the food of box-like packaging, the box-like perfume (or spice) of item
Cigarette, capsule packaging cosmetics wait for boxed article to stack and be sent into corrugated case, to carry and to transport.Corrugated case
It is folded and is formed by corrugated board, each composition face of babinet does not have outer extensional matter, causes article vanning inconvenient;And corrugated case is not
With pretightning force, in transportational process, it is mutually shifted friction between the article in carton, is also easy to produce damage;Still further, corrugation
Carton is not easy to recycle, and results in waste of resources, environmental pollution.In order to overcome these deficiencies, a kind of flexible enclosure is provided.
Invention content
The technical problem to be solved by the present invention is to:A kind of flexible enclosure is provided, it not only has outer extensional energy, conveniently waits for
It transports the vanning of article and unloads case;And also there is pretightning force, transport article is not damaged in effective protection box body;The box body simultaneously
It is also convenient for recycling, environmental protection and energy saving.
The present invention solve its technical problem the technical solution adopted is that:A kind of flexible enclosure, is connected by tablet and is surrounded, adjacent
Two tablets are connected by flexible connector;The flexible connector is configured as deforming, for compensating the tablet
Movement relative to the flexible connector.
Flexible enclosure just due to the embodiment of the present invention using the above structure, in any two adjacent panels for surrounding box body
Between the flexible connector of above structure is set so that there is connection type flexible, so by article between adjacent panels
When being packed into box body or being drawn off out of box body, first tablet is pulled outwardly to open the box body by external force, to effectively increase
The space of the receiving article of big box body, is convenient for the handling of article;After the completion of crater makees, box body is under the action of flexible connector
It restores, and certain pretightning force is generated to article to be shipped in box body, it will not be because mutually squeezing to transport article in effective protection box body
And it damages;After unloading case, box body can be overlapped, reduce box body occupied space, convenient for recycling, environmental protection and energy saving.
Flexible enclosure according to the above embodiment of the present invention can also have following additional technical characteristic:
The flexible connector is equipped with recessed crooked position, and the article that so can effectively prevent in flexible connector box body is pushed up
To deformation.
There are two the ends being open for the flexible enclosure tool so that article to be shipped is sent into or is unloaded from two ports of box body
Go out, it is easy to operation.
The box body further comprises time for having magnetic attraction that be used to maintain the distance between described two neighboring tablet
Bit architecture, to further increase the pretightning force of box body.
The return structure for having magnetic attraction is manufactured by magnetic material, and is fixed on the tablet.
It is hinged between the tablet and the flexible connector, it is described to have the return structure of magnetic attraction for articulated shaft, it is described
Tablet offers the open tubular column passed through for articulated shaft with the flexible connector.
The flexible connector is fixed on by instillation process on tablet.
The flexible connector is spring.
The tablet is equipped with lead angle with the flexible connector connection.
Sliding rail is offered on the flexible connector, it is described to have the return structure of magnetic attraction to be fixed on the tablet
On cylinder, the cylinder moves along sliding rail, to pull open or the distance of the two neighboring tablet of push away near.

Fig. 1 shows the connection relationship diagram according to invention flexible enclosure middle plateform.By four pieces of tablets 01 in the box body
Connect and surround, the tablet 01 by including such as metal, plastics, hardboard either the rigidity of wood or elasticity material system
Make.The box body set there are two be open end 11, convenient for article to be shipped from the end of the opening 11 be sent into box body or from
Box body is drawn off.The inboard wall of cartridge is equipped with RFID information identification card, and the RFID information identification card is stored with for operating, indicating
Related information, including the instruction of destination information, lift van, verification etc..
Fig. 2 shows the schematic side elevations of flexible enclosure of the present invention.The tablet 01 of box body is surrounded, two neighboring tablet 01 is logical
It crosses flexible connector 02 to be connected, the flexible connector 02 is configured as deforming, opposite for compensating the tablet 01
In the movement of the flexible connector 02.
In this way, showing the stress diagram of flexible enclosure middle plateform of the present invention referring to Fig. 3, have between adjacent panels 01 soft
The connection type of property so that four tablets 01 of box body form outward state under the action of by external force, are convenient for
Article to be shipped, i.e., be sent into box body, while being also convenient for the article in box body and drawing off operation by " feeding case " operation;Also make the box body
Four tablets 01 not under by outer force effect, inwardly clamp naturally, to the article in clamping box body, to be worth mentioning
It is that the return structure for having magnetic attraction for maintaining the distance between the two neighboring tablet 01 can be set on tablet 01,
This has the return structure of magnetic attraction to be manufactured by magnetic material so that when box body does not receive outer force effect, it is inside to reinforce tablet 01
The pretightning force gripped helps to improve the clamping to the article in box body;Still further, showing flexibility of the invention referring to Fig. 4
The schematic figure of box body overlapping, after the article in box body is drawn off, flexible connector 02 contributes to the overlapping of box body, can reduce box
Body occupied space, convenient for recycling, environmental protection and energy saving.
Fig. 5, Fig. 6 and Fig. 7 illustrate an embodiment schematic expanded view of flexible enclosure of the present invention.If Fig. 5 shows, this implementation
It is hinged between the tablet 01 and the flexible connector 02 in example.Specifically, tablet sky is offered in the end of tablet 01
Stem 13, the flexible connector 02, should by including that the flexible materials such as rubber, silica gel, plastic macromolecule material make
The end of flexible connector 02 offer with the tablet open tubular column 13 matched elastic hollow column 22, have magnetic attraction by described
Return structure is arranged to articulated shaft 31, and articulated shaft 31 passes through the tablet open tubular column 13 and elastic hollow column 22, to realize tablet
01 with the hinged relationship of the flexible connector 02.
Further, the flexible connector 02 is equipped with recessed crooked position 21, referring to the flexible connector 02 shown in Fig. 6
Schematic expanded view in return, when box body is in clamped condition, the setting of recessed crooked position 21 can effectively avoid box body
Interior angle is damaged the article 04 being contained in box body, and the recessed crooked position 21 selectively takes the shape of the letter U(As Fig. 6 shows), W-shaped, V-arrangement
Shape or other shaped(As Fig. 5 or Fig. 8 show)Setting;Article 04 to further avoid being contained in box body is bruised, in tablet
01 end set lead angle 12.Fig. 7 be the present embodiment in flexible connector 02 open schematic expanded view, the tablet 01 by
When external force is opened, the recessed crooked position 21 deforms to compensate the outside displacement distance of tablet 01.
Another step as above-described embodiment is improved, and as shown in Figure 8 and Figure 9, place unlike the embodiments above is:It will
The flexible connector 02 is directly anchored to by instillation process on tablet 01, and Fig. 8 embodies the present embodiment flexible connector 02
The signal state of return, Fig. 9 are the signal state diagram for embodying 02 stress of the present embodiment flexible connector opening.Art technology
Those of ordinary skill will be appreciated by, and in further example embodiment, flexible connector 02 is arranged to spring
Mechanism(It is not shown in figure for clarity).
Figure 10 and Figure 11 respectively illustrates the flexible connector 02 according to another embodiment of example of the present invention, the elasticity
Connector 02 is arranged in indent arcuation, and offers sliding rail 23, the return for having magnetic attraction in the flexible connector 02
Structure is the cylinder 32 being fixed on adjacent two tablet 01, and the cylinder 32 is arranged across the sliding rail 23 so that
Cylinder 32 is moved along sliding rail 23.If Figure 10 shows, under the action of the magnetic attraction of cylinder 32, cylinder 32 is slided along sliding rail 23
It is dynamic to make article of adjacent two tablets, 01 return to be accommodated in clamping box body;If Figure 11 shows, under the effect of external force, tablet 01 by
It is opened outside power, drives cylinder 32 sliding outside sliding rail 23, to open the box body.
